This version now is up to 55 dyes. Separated into three different containers. NPC, Outfit and Class.
This means there are 41 new dyes in this update.
Includes all starter outfit colours as dyes.
Every dye even if it comes from presets has custom properties put together by me.
There are also some dyes completely done by me going by eye on what some things looked like in early access, this includes the two EA Volo Dyes as well as the Astarion EA dye.
The Harper dyes do have slight variations such as different leather shades or blues. I thought at first they did look too much the same but the different variations are nice to choose between depending on the outfit.
Completely custom dye icons. They do not look like vials and instead are supposed to show the overall colour scheme of the dye itself. The mod also includes a little fun addition to explain this icon.
I tried to also make fun little descriptions for the dyes where I could.

What is this mod?
Dyes made from the base values NPC outfits have as well as some outfits as well. So you can match your companions or continue yours and their outfit colour scheme going.
This is separate to my Custom Dyes to make handling the mod easier but also easier for people to pick which they prefer. Since I know my custom ones aren't to everyone's tastes. They were made for myself and friends which I then chose to share. That page also has a sample template if you want to attempt your own.
For Karlach dye I did use all the values from her outfits colour material. But I assume they didn't edit all of them from base values since its unique to her and her outfit mostly uses the leather, metal and the accent colours rather than the cloth, color1/2/3 and custom color values. However I may make an alternative version where I edit the cloth, color1/2/3 and custom color values to more similar colours to the leather and such.
